"Lock" users into TouchChat using the new Guided Access® from Apple®

Posted Sep 19, 2012 - 3:25pm

Hurray- it’s finally here! Many of you have been asking for it and Apple® has listened. With the release of iOs 6 today, you now have the ability to “lock” users into TouchChat, preventing them from exiting the app and getting off task. **Please note that if you update your iOs software to iOs 6, you will need to update your TouchChat software with the new version 1.2.4, available in iTunes®.

This new feature from Apple® is called Guided Access®. To get there, choose Settings>General>Accessibility>Guided Access. Guided Access® keeps the iPad® in a single app, and allows you to control which features are available. Turn it On and set a password. Most people will also benefit by turning on “Enable Screen Sleep”. To start Guided Access®, triple-click the Home button in the app you want to use. Now you are given the option to disable certain functions, i.e. you might want to turn off the “Motion” option if your client prefers to keep the screen in the same orientation. Choose Start when all settings are set.

To get back to iOS options, triple click the home button and enter your password.

NOTE: We suggest always “closing” (not minimizing) all other apps prior to locking someone’s system in TouchChat. To close apps, double tap the Home button, and push and hold one of the apps listed in the line at the bottom of the screen. Choose the – button for each app, but TouchChat. Then, tap the Home button. Open TouchChat and triple click the Home button to start Guided Access®.
